    Why Commercial Appliance Disposal Is Different

    Commercial appliances contain materials that require careful handling. Refrigerants (Freon and newer alternatives) in refrigerators, freezers, and HVAC systems are regulated under EPA Section 608. These refrigerants must be recovered by a certified technician before the unit can be disposed of. You can't just haul a commercial walk-in freezer to the landfill and call it done.

    EFE works with certified technicians for refrigerant recovery when required. We coordinate that piece so you don't have to chase down multiple vendors. Once the refrigerant is properly handled, we haul the unit for recycling or disposal.

    For other commercial appliances, responsible disposal means separating metal components for recycling and ensuring electronic components go to a certified e-waste processor rather than a general landfill.

    How Commercial Appliance Removal Is Priced

    Commercial appliance pricing depends on:

  • Type and size of the unit — A commercial range is far more labor-intensive than a break room refrigerator
  • Whether refrigerant recovery is required — This adds a coordination step and associated cost, but it's non-negotiable legally
  • Access — Is the unit in a kitchen with narrow doorways, or is it accessible via a loading dock?
  • Volume — If you're clearing an entire kitchen or multiple units in one visit, we price the full job

    Q: Do I need to disconnect the appliances before you arrive?

    A: For most appliances, we prefer that gas lines and plumbing connections are already disconnected by a licensed plumber or your facilities team before we arrive. Electrical disconnects are typically something your electrician or property maintenance handles. We haul once it's safely disconnected.     Q: How long does commercial appliance removal typically take?

    A: A single large appliance (commercial refrigerator, industrial range) usually takes 30 to 90 minutes depending on access. A full kitchen equipment cleanout can take a half day or more. We'll estimate the time when we quote the job.
